One type of verbal phrase is a gerund phrase, which includes a gerund (a verb ending in -ing) and any modifiers or complements. This type of phrase functions as a noun in a sentence.
To change a verbal phrase to a mathematical phrase, first identify the key terms and relationships described in the verbal statement. Translate words into mathematical symbols or operations; for instance, "sum" becomes "+" and "product" becomes "×." Additionally, assign variables to unknown quantities as needed. Finally, ensure that the structure of the mathematical expression reflects the logical relationships outlined in the verbal phrase.
